The study site is situated within an alley linking a residential enclave and a primary school in downtown Shanghai. These narrow passageways, remnants of large-scale historical development, now serve as urban residual spaces. They offer an opportunity for revitalization efforts aimed at enhancing community life and providing essential amenities within the constraints of limited space.



This alley is lack of design, it divides the pedestrian and vehicular space by using posts. The distance between posts becomes a familiar scale of public space in everyday life. Apply this distance to generate grid and colume, it becomes a modular approach which serves as the foundation for a versatile public infrastructure. Inspired by the concept of tangram, these foundational modules can be configured in over 2,000 different combinations. This adaptability enables the replication and expansion of the system to suit the unique needs of various neighborhoods.



Tangram is a Chinese puzzle dating from the late eighteenth or early nineteenth century. It consists of seven flat pieces: two large triangles, two small triangles, a medium-size triangle, a square, and a parallelogram. These seven pieces has more than 2000 different combinations.



The Tanacube represents a three-dimensional evolution of the Tangram, offering remarkable flexibility in creating diverse street furniture. Its adaptable design, comprised of various combinations of columns and panels, facilitates a wide array of activities catering to different demographics. This versatility ensures that the urban space can accommodate the needs and preferences of various community groups effectively.
